博客


宝塔面板在NGINX环境中TP5.1如何运行?


宝塔面板默认开的站点是不能跑得起tp5.1的站点的要修改下配置文件!

在web面板中点配置然后修改如下:

location ~ \.php(.*)$ {
		root   D:/wwwroot/127.0.0.1;
		fastcgi_pass   127.0.0.1:4556;
		fastcgi_index  index.php;
        fastcgi_split_path_info ^(.+\.php)(.*)$;
        fastcgi_param PATH_INFO $fastcgi_path_info;
		fastcgi_param  SCRIPT_FILENAME  $document_root$fastcgi_script_name;
		include        fastcgi_params;
}

有时我们的tp后台要用到admin.php 但宝塔的默认的伪静态设置会让admin.php有问题 应该这样设,如下

location / { 
if (!-e $request_filename){
rewrite ^(.*)$ /index.php?s=$1 last;
}
}

location /admin.php {
#后台,不隐藏admin.php,成功
}

直接复制进去就成了 然后就OK了。


上一篇:哪些域名能备案,哪些不能备案?

下一篇:新网站的SEO前期基础应该如何做?